THERMAL PHASE-TRANSITION OF CESIUM FORMATE

摘要
The phase transition of cesium formate observed at around 36 degrees C was found to be a reversible first-order transition by means of thermal analyses, The results of the Rietveld analysis of powder X-ray diffraction data showed that an orthorhombic phase (Pbcm, Z = 8; a = 4.785(1), b = 9.553(9), and c = 15.927(2) Angstrom) transformed to a cubic phase (Pm3m, Z = 1; a = 4.500(5) Angstrom). The large values of enthalpy and entropy change for the transition (Delta H-tr = 6.87 +/- 0.28 kJ mol(-1) and Delta S-tr = 22.2 +/- 0.9 J K-1 mol(-1)) were discussed on the basis of the change of the orientation freedom of the formate ion.
